Use of Cookies

This website uses cookies. Cookies are small-sized rich-text format files that allow certain information about users to be stored on their terminal devices when a web page is visited. Cookies may be stored on your device through your browser during your first visit to a website, and when you revisit the same site with the same device, your browser checks for a cookie registered to that site. If such a record exists, the data within is transmitted to the website you are visiting. This enables the website to detect your previous visit and tailor the content accordingly.

Your Rights Under the KVKK

According to Article 11 of the Law on the Protection of Personal Data (KVKK) No. 6698, everyone has the right to apply to the data controller and request the following regarding their personal data:

  1. To learn whether personal data is being processed.
  2. To request information if personal data has been processed.
  3. To learn the purpose of processing and whether personal data is used in accordance with its purpose.
  4. To know the third parties to whom personal data has been transferred domestically or abroad.
  5. To request the correction of incomplete or inaccurate personal data.
  6. To request the deletion or destruction of personal data within the framework of the conditions stipulated in Article 7 of the KVKK.
  7. To request notification of the correction, deletion, or destruction operations to third parties to whom personal data has been transferred.
  8. To object to any outcome arising against them as a result of the analysis of personal data exclusively through automated systems.
  9. To demand compensation for damages in case of unlawful processing of personal data.

Your Rights Under the GDPR

Under the G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ation of the EU), you have the following rights:

  1. Right to access your personal data.
  2. Right to request correction of your personal data.
  3. Right to request deletion of your personal data (right to be forgotten).
  4. Right to request restriction of data processing.
  5. Right to data portability.
  6. Right to object to the processing of your personal data.
  7. Rights related to automated decision-making and profiling.
  8. Right to be informed in the event of a personal data breach.
